What the role is all about:
Our Software Engineers play a critical role in Vitality’s successful business model by building and maintaining software solutions. You will work in line with quality and time parameters, to offer brilliant products with seamless, intuitive customer journeys.
You will act as an intermediate authority with experience in building full solutions across journey. You will have the chance to work closely with stakeholders/product owners and a wide variety of internal and external technical teams.   
Key Actions

Implement the software development life cycle: build, maintain, test, deliver, release and document user-friendly and customer centric software solutions, as required.
Deliver to standards: Understand and apply Vitality’s defined technical and process standards to ensure the effective management of risks and the protection of Vitality’s data.
Provide integrated solutions: ensure solutions are user-focused, well aligned and effectively integrated across multiple teams and platforms to ensure the business needs are met.
Engage stakeholders. Collaborate, work with and develop an understanding of the needs and requirements of both internal and external stakeholders in order to achieve the desired outcomes.
Build and transfer skills and knowledge. Take responsibility for developing personal skills and expertise aligned to role.
Collaborate within and across teams. Work effectively together with others across varying areas of expertise to achieve the required results.   
Essential Skills needed to fulfil this role:

Minimum 2-3+ years proven work experience in Full stack Software Engineering
Advanced knowledge of multiple programming languages, such as .NET, Javascript (RXX XX XX XX XX), Graph QL, Type Script , SQL Server or Postgres, DB schema & API swagger
Experience with a range of modern web application frameworks and integration technologies
Full stack development experience including web, services (microservices) and databases
Analytical skills to interpret complex relationships and data sets
Effective written and verbal communication skills to train, coach and collaborate with other staff and management.
Able to demonstrate working knowledge in following software engineering specialisms: Engineering standards and Practises; User Experience; Low level specifications, Technical Analysis; Performance; DevOps and CI/CD tooling

Vitality is a multi-award-winning UK insurance brand, here to make the world a healthier, happier place.
We’ve been a purpose and values-driven business from day 1- long before it became fashionable. Our core purpose is to make people healthier and enhance protect their lives. Vitality pioneered shared-value insurance. We incentivise people to live healthier longer lives - they benefit, our business benefits, and society benefits.
